7 Critical Warning Signs in AI-Generated Designs Before CNC Machining
The rise of AI-generated CAD models and generative design has changed modern manufacturing more than almost any other digital shift in the last decade. Today, engineers can create complex geometries in minutes using CAD automation , optimize structures for strength and weight, and even generate ready-to-use machining data through G-code generation systems. On paper, this sounds like a perfect workflow for faster production and smarter engineering. But in real-world CNC machining , things are not that simple. A design that looks perfect in simulation can easily fail when it reaches the CNC mill . Why? Because AI focuses on mathematical optimization, not manufacturing reality. It does not fully understand tool limitations, machine dynamics, or physical constraints like workholding , cutter access, or thermal behavior. This is where problems begin.
